def get_tick_padding(self):
"""
Get the length of the tick outside of the axes.
"""
padding = {
'in': 0.0,
'inout': 0.5,
'out': 1.0
}
return self._size * padding[self._tickdir]

def get_tick_padding(self):
values = []
if len(self.majorTicks):
values.append(self.majorTicks[0].get_tick_padding())
if len(self.minorTicks):
values.append(self.minorTicks[0].get_tick_padding())
if len(values):
return max(values)
return 0.0
